Brokeback Mountain

Year: 2005

Director: Ang Lee Starring: Heath Ledger / Jack Gyllenhaal

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

That year's "Brokeback Mountain" swept almost all major film festivals.

Won the Golden Lion in Venice.

After receiving 8 nominations at the Oscars, director Ang Lee won back the first best director.

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

however.

This classic, which seems to be a classic in today's view, was questioned at that time.

Conservative and religious groups in the United States have launched a 60,000-person joint boycott of "Brokeback Mountain" to the Oscars.

The most conservative Utah movie theater simply banned the film.

There have also been repeated resistances and setbacks during theatrical screenings:

The film was released in only 683 theaters in the United States and grossed only $30 million at the box office.

For society's prejudice against homosexuality, Brokeback Mountain is of great significance.

The Funeral of the Rose

Year: 1969

导导: Matsumoto Toshio

Writers: Toshio Matsumoto

Starring: Shinnosuke Ikehata / Yoshio Tsuchiya

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

Director Toshio Matsumoto is one of the three pillars of Japanese independent cinema;

It is on a par with Shuji Terayama and Nagisa Oshima.

The character modeling, violent scenes, and degraded shots in the film, accompanied by the acceleration of the music, give people a feeling of "fast forward".

These methods are considered by critics to have directly influenced Kubrick's Clockwork Orange.

The film tells the story of a transvestite male prostitute in an underground gay bar.

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

I grew up without a father.

Because the mother married a new couple, she stabbed her mother and lover to death.

After that, he cohabited with the club owner.

The boss accidentally found that the little boyfriend was actually his own son.

thereupon.

The father committed suicide by cutting his stomach, and the male prostitute poked his blind eyes.

"The Funeral of the Rose" is known as the first work of the Japanese New Wave and the first work to open up the gay culture of Japanese cinema.

"My Own Ihoda"

Year: 1991

Director: Gus Van Sant

Writers: Gus Van Sant / Shakespeare

Starring: Rivan Phoenix / Keanu Reeves

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

Both Mike and Scott are male prostitutes on the streets.

But there are very different family backgrounds.

Michael is full of shattered childhood memories, bent on finding his long-lost mother;

Scott's father, however, was the mayor, and he allowed himself to degenerate only to humiliate his powerful father.

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

The two friends traveled from Portland via Seattle and Edhe to Italy.

During the journey, I met all kinds of people and experienced the pain and happiness of life.

Finally broke up because of a different fate.

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

The classic confession in the film is actually played freely by Phoenix:

Scott: “And two guys can't love each other.” (Two men can't fall in love.) )

Mike: “Yeah. Well, I don't know. I mean... I mean, for me, I could love someone even if I, you know, wasn't paid for it... I love you, and... You don't pay me.” (I don't know, I mean, for me, I can love someone, not for the money.) I love you and you don't have to pay me. )

After the film, Keanu Reeves became popular;

However, Phoenix was infected with drugs and could not extricate himself.

In October 1993, he died of drug abuse in the bar of his friend Johnny Depp at the age of 23.

Straight male cancer please go away, here is the greatest LGBT film list in film history

"No paparazzi, I want to be anonymous."

It became his last words.

After making "My Private Ehoda," Phoenix said that my work would have been much older than I am.

As it turned out, he was right.
